1. Bell Tents with Hotel-Grade Interiors



Bell camping tents continue to be one of one of the most popular options for deluxe glamping thanks to their stylish shape and sizable interiors. What collections premium bell camping tents apart is the focus to information inside: luxurious king-size beds, Egyptian cotton bed linens, woven rugs, and ambient illumination develop a room that feels a lot more like a boutique hotel space than a camping site. Adding a little resting area with a leather elbow chair or an analysis nook raises the experience also better.

Design Tips



Select canvas walls in neutral tones like lotion or sage environment-friendly to keep the interior intense. Layer appearances with synthetic fur tosses, tasseled pillows, and all-natural wood furnishings to stabilize rustic charm with refined comfort. A statement light fixture, also a battery-powered one, can immediately transform the atmosphere after sundown.

2. Safari-Style Tents for Classic Elegance



Influenced by timeless African safari lodges, safari-style outdoors tents bring an air of journey and sophistication. These structures usually feature high ceilings, canvas and wood framework, and big watching home windows that frame the surrounding landscape. Interiors typically consist of four-poster beds, classic trunks, brass components, and en-suite washrooms with clawfoot bathtubs.

Why Guests Love Them



Safari tents use a feeling of expedition without giving up convenience. The mix of all-natural products and heritage-inspired decoration attract travelers looking for a timeless, story-rich experience rather than a simply contemporary one.

3. Geodesic Domes for a Modern Spin



For an extra modern aesthetic, geodesic domes are an excellent option to standard canvas outdoors tents. Their clear panels enable visitors to daydream from bed, while the strong structure endures wind and rain better than material choices. Domes function especially well in remarkable landscapes such as deserts, mountains, or coastal cliffs where the view is the main attraction.

Furnishing a Dome



Because domes have bent wall surfaces, furnishings ought to be maintained inconspicuous and main. A system bed, a portable wood-burning oven, and minimal shelving maintain the room functional while maintaining an open, ventilated feel. Warm lighting strips along the dome's structure include a wonderful radiance in the evening.

4. Overwater and Raised Platform Tents



Raised camping tents built on wooden systems over water, woodland floors, or uneven surface add both drama and practicality. Raising the outdoor tents shields visitors from moisture and wildlife while supplying scenic views that ground-level lodgings can't match. These arrangements are specifically prominent in tropical or riverside locations.

Secret Features to Include



An exclusive deck with outside seating, a hammock, or perhaps a tiny plunge swimming pool improves the elevated experience. Wraparound netting or glass panels keep the area open up to nature while maintaining comfort and insect security.

5. Yurts with Rich, Layered Interiors



Yurts bring a warm, cocoon-like ambience thanks to their round form and insulated wall surfaces. Unlike thin canvas camping tents, yurts handle temperature level extremes well, making them suitable for four-season glamping. Interior design often leans right into a bohemian or Mongolian-inspired style, with patterned fabrics, low seats, and a central wood stove.

Including Individual Touches



Consider a skylight at the yurt's crown for all-natural light and stargazing, paired with layered carpets and floor paddings to create a comfy common area.
